Asphalt cracks repair services involve the process of identifying and fixing cracks that develop in asphalt surfaces such as driveways, parking lots, and walkways. Over time, exposure to weather, temperature fluctuations, and regular use can cause asphalt to develop small or large cracks. Repair typically includes cleaning out the cracks, filling them with specialized materials, and sealing the surface to prevent further deterioration. This process helps restore the integrity of the asphalt, making it safer and more durable for everyday use.
Cracks in asphalt can lead to a variety of problems if left unaddressed. Water can seep into the cracks, causing the underlying base to weaken and eventually leading to larger potholes or surface failures. Additionally, cracks can pose tripping hazards for pedestrians and reduce the overall appearance of a property. Repairing these cracks promptly can prevent more extensive and costly repairs down the line, as well as maintain the functional and aesthetic quality of the asphalt surface.

The overview below groups typical Asphalt Cracks Repair projects into broad ranges so you can see how smaller, mid-sized, and larger jobs often compare in your area.
In many markets, a large share of routine jobs stays in the lower and middle ranges, while only a smaller percentage of projects moves into the highest bands when the work is more complex or site conditions are harder than average.
Smaller Repairs - Typical costs for minor crack repairs in asphalt driveways or parking lots range from $250 to $600. Many routine jobs fall within this middle range, depending on the extent of the damage and local rates.
Moderate Repairs - Larger crack filling or patching projects usually cost between $600 and $1,500. These projects are common for properties needing more extensive repairs but not full replacement.
Severe Damage or Large Areas - Extensive crack repair or resurfacing can range from $1,500 to $3,500, with some larger projects reaching higher costs. Fewer projects push into this higher tier, often involving significant surface prep or multiple sections.
Full Asphalt Replacement - Complete removal and replacement of asphalt surfaces typically start around $4,000 and can exceed $10,000 for large or complex jobs. Local contractors provide estimates based on the size and condition of the area needing work.
Actual totals will depend on details like access to the work area, the scope of the project, and the materials selected, so use these as general starting points rather than exact figures.

What causes asphalt cracks? Asphalt cracks can result from temperature fluctuations, ground movement, heavy traffic, or poor installation practices.
Are asphalt cracks harmful to the pavement? Small cracks can allow water to seep in, potentially leading to further damage like potholes or more extensive cracking.
What types of asphalt cracks do local contractors repair? Contractors typically repair all common crack types, including transverse, longitudinal, and block cracks.
How do professionals fix asphalt cracks? Repair methods may include crack sealing, filling, or patching, depending on the crack size and severity.
Can asphalt cracks be prevented? Proper maintenance, timely repairs, and sealing can help minimize the development of new cracks over time.
